WebOvertime Pay Rules in Iowa. Iowa employers must pay time and a half to all workers (1.5 times the regular hourly rate) for all hours over 40 worked during a week. Some employees are not covered by this (see below). The principal focus of this paper is on the legal rights and protection... can anyone have an iraWebIowa labor laws require employers to grant a meal period of at least thirty (30) minutes to employees under the age of sixteen (16) scheduled to work five (5) or more consecutive hours. Iowa Code 92.7.
